It's been so far so good for Channel 4's reboot of The Crystal Maze, especially now the series has reverted back to the original format of non-celebrity contestants (for better and for worse).
And it looks like this week's episode is set to really focus on the series' nostalgia factor, bringing back a contestant who originally appeared on the show back in 1992 for another crack at the Maze, hosted by an entirely different Maze Master called Richard.
Heather first appeared on The Crystal Maze back in the show's third season in the early '90s in a team of strangers, where she was led around the zones by original host Richard O'Brien.
Back in 1992, Heather was an 18-year-old from Birmingham studying for her A-Levels, who managed to earn her team two crystals from the challenges she undertook in the Medieval and Aztec Zones.
Unfortunately, the team failed to crack the dome itself, leaving with just a commemorative crystal.
Fast forward 25 years and Heather is now an Oxfordshire-based fitness instructor, and still keen to compete for those crystals in the four zones of the maze – and this time she's joined by a team of her friends, all of whom are black belts in martial arts.

Heather was lucky to secure a second appearance on the show as Channel 4 revealed a few months ago that over 30,000 people had applied to be on the '90s revival series.
So far this year we've also seen a host of celebrities including Vicky Pattison, Louie Spence, Ore Oduba and Alex Brooker take on the Maze, with highlights including a spat between Stacey Solomon and her boyfriend Joe Swash.
We also enjoyed seeing Joey Essex take on the Planet Walk much more than we care to admit.
The Crystal Maze airs on Fridays at 8pm on Channel 4.
